Japanese troops invade a small village in China but the massacre is added upon by the presence of a Blood Demon who's possessed one of the soldiers. Chor (Lau Kong) sacrifices himself in order to stop the demon, the cave it originated from is sealed up and his young son Kong is raised by another family. When we cut to the Cultural Revolution in progress many years later, we see Kong (Lam Ching Ying) being viewed upon with jealousy by the other son of his adoptive family, Tung (Tony Leung Kar Fai). The latter therefore engages himself heavily in the revolution movement and sees his chance to expel Kong by claiming he's an anti-revolutionary. However the seal that has kept the Blood Demon out is broken and it goes on its possession rampage, eventually planting itself firmly in General Lui (Guan Shan). Chor and Kong has to unite, forget past differences and get Lui's daughter Shan (Joey Wong) to believe her father is an evil in red...
